  • Abstract
    In this paper, methods of conformal antenna RCS reduction are researched, similar with planar antenna. Design of two conformal microstrip antenna, resonant at the same frequency, the former is an ordinary antenna. The other uses impedance loaded as well as ground plane and patch slotted technique. The results demonstrate that in 2 - 8GHz, the latter conformal microstrip antenna RCS achieve a good reduction, up to 20dB. At the same time, the antenna gain loss of only 0.2dB.
